Pros of battery storage
-
Maximises your solar energy use: With a battery, you can use almost all the energy your solar panels generate by storing excess power and using it when needed, rather than exporting it back to the grid.
-
Reduces electricity costs: A battery can decrease your reliance on the electricity grid, saving you money on your power bills. This is particularly beneficial during peak usage times when electricity rates are higher.
Cons of battery storage
-
High initial cost: The upfront cost of a battery can be significant and might not provide an immediate financial return. For many, the cost might outweigh the benefits, so it's essential to calculate whether the savings on your electricity bills will cover the cost of the battery over its useful life.
-
Efficiency losses: Batteries are not 100% efficient - some energy is lost during the process of charging and discharging. Typically, you can expect about a 10% loss in stored energy.
Other things to take into consideration
-
Batteries must be installed according to specific safety standards and local regulations, including placement restrictions.
-
Make sure your battery meets relevant safety and quality standards. Use batteries listed on approved lists like the Clean Energy Council's to ensure they have been tested and meet stringent criteria.
-
Check the warranty conditions and expected lifetime of the battery, which can be influenced by factors like the number of charge cycles and total energy throughput.
-
If your solar system is small and doesn't often produce excess energy, a battery might not be necessary. However, for larger systems or in areas with high electricity rates, a battery could offer significant benefits.
